Responsibilities
  • Serve food to residents according to individual diets and preferences.
  • Control portion sizes of food items.
  • Follow safety precautions, report unsafe incidents or equipment issues, and adhere to safety procedures.
  • Operate equipment safely, document temperatures, and follow up as needed.
  • Deliver catering to hospital locations, including handling dirty dishes.
  • Maintain proper food temperatures during service.
  • Assist Cooks with food preparation, including salads, vegetables, and fruits, and follow instructions for simple food items.
  • Clear plates and trays, operate dishwashers, and clean utensils and cookware.
  • Assist with food prep according to the daily prep list.
  • Properly store and label dietary supplies and leftovers.
  • Check and document food temperatures and quality, follow HACCP guidelines, and take corrective actions as needed.
  • Ensure equipment and work areas are cleaned and sanitized.
  • Set up for catering events, including linens, equipment, and special requests.
  • Adhere to departmental policies on quality, safety, and infection control.
  • Assemble nourishment carts and stock kitchenettes.
  • Participate in meetings and training sessions.
  • Perform other duties as assigned.
Requirements
  • Completion or enrollment in a Food Service Worker Program meeting Ontario Long-Term Care Homes Act requirements.
  • Food Handler Certification approved by Public Health.
  • Availability to work days, evenings, weekends, and holidays.
  • Ability to perform moderate to heavy lifting and stand for long periods.
  • Current (within 6 months) VPS screening.
  • Experience in a kitchen or food service setting preferred.
